Reload data from Lehigh says COL of 2.800 which is normal. But this puts the BTO around 2.100 and for me a jump of .15" which is not normal. When seated at 2.800 OAL the projectile sits flush with the last groove edge sort of like a cannelour.
If I seat the bullet with a more normal jump say .04" the OAL is 2.9+ and won't fit in my mags. Not the end of the world if I have to single feed for now. When seated the projectile shows entire first groove.
Just wondering your guys thoughts on this. Pros and cons of doing one vs the other? I'm leaning towards published data.
